Texto da carta

Toda vez que você conjura uma mágica instantânea ou um feitiço, a criatura alvo que um oponente controla não pode bloquear neste turno.

"Não prendam ele! Alistem ele!" — Comandante Yaszen

Smelt-Ward Minotaur stands out in the pantheon of red creatures in Magic: The Gathering due to its penchant for controlling the battlefield. In a similar bracket, we have cards like Ember Hauler, which offers solid creature removal albeit at the cost of sacrificing itself. The strategic depth of Smelt-Ward Minotaur lies in its ability to consistently disable a blocker whenever you cast an instant or sorcery spell, thus clearing the path for other attackers without the need for self-sacrifice.

Another comparable card is Bloodrage Brawler, a creature that sets players on an aggressive path due to its high power and low casting cost. It compels a discard upon entry, aligning with red’s theme of immediacy and impact. However, Smelt-Ward Minotaur doesn’t demand a discard, focusing instead on strategic combat engagement. Then there’s Ahn-Crop Crasher, with exertion to prevent blocking, offering a one-time use per exertion as opposed to Smelt-Ward’s repeatable effect.

In weighing the capabilities and utilities of Smelt-Ward Minotaur against these cards, the Minotaur’s persistent capacity to manipulate combat phases makes it a potent choice for players crafting a deck around spell-slinging and tactical aggression in creature-based strategies.

Regras e informações

O guia de referência para regras de cartas de Magic: The Gathering Minotauro do Bairro da Fundição fornece decisões oficiais, quaisquer erratas emitidas, bem como um registro de todas as modificações funcionais que ocorreram.

Data Texto
2018-10-05 Resolving Smelt-Ward Minotaur’s triggered ability after a creature has blocked won’t remove the blocking creature from combat or cause the creature it blocked to become unblocked.
2018-10-05 Smelt-Ward Minotaur’s triggered ability resolves before the spell that caused it to trigger. It resolves even if that spell is countered.
